The Ultimate Guide to eLearning Localization

eLearning content is becoming increasingly popular globally. To guarantee its impact and resonate with a wider audience, it's vital to localize more info your materials.

Localization involves adapting your eLearning content to meet the cultural, linguistic, and regional requirements of your target audience. This includes more than just adapting text.

It also necessitates consideration of graphical elements, sound, and even the overall structure of your eLearning experience.

A well-localized eLearning course can increase learner motivation, improve retention, and ultimately lead to improved learning outcomes.

To achieve successful eLearning localization, consider these key stages:

* Conduct a thorough needs analysis to identify your target audiences' cultural and linguistic requirements.

* Employ a consistent style guide and glossary to maintain accuracy and brand consistency across all localized materials.

* Test and review your localized content thoroughly to ensure it is clear, accurate, and culturally sensitive.

* Continuously monitor and improve your localization efforts based on learner feedback and evolving market needs.

By following these best practices, you can produce a truly global eLearning experience that empowers learners worldwide.

Connecting Global Audiences With Online Course Localization

In today's interconnected world, offering online courses to a global audience is an attractive opportunity. However, simply translating your course content doesn't guarantee success. Effective localization involves customizing the entire learning experience to resonate with varied cultural norms and preferences.

  • Think about specific holidays, humor, and even the way information is communicated.
  • Employ professional translators who comprehend not only the language but also the cultural context.
  • Confirm your online platform is usable in multiple languages.

Via meticulous localization, you can foster a truly welcoming learning environment that promotes global engagement and achieves outstanding results.
